Love’s offering tire inflation service while drivers fuel

by Truck News

OKLAHOMA CITY, Okla. — Love’s Travel Stop is now offering a new tire inflation and inspection service, while drivers fuel up.

Love’s TirePass is now available at 75 Love’s Travel Stop locations, with the remainder of those that have truck tire care centers to be online by August.

While the driver is fuelling at a TirePass fuelling lane, a trained technician hooks up the truck and trailer tires to automatic inflators stationed around the vehicle. Tires are inflated to the correct pressure. Drivers receive a report showing the status of their tires. Fleets can request monthly reports detailing all assessments performed on their equipment throughout the month.

“Customers have been asking for more tire maintenance services that don’t add time to their stops,” said Dan Jensen, director of tire sales and service for Love’s. “TirePass provides a crucial service without tacking on downtime. It’s a safety tool that can keep customers on the road by detecting problems ahead of time. The best part is it’s all done while the driver fuels.”
